Balancing Security with Speed: The Underlying Technology
The first question that comes to mind is how no verification casinos ensure safety while bypassing traditional KYC (Know Your Customer) protocols. Many of these platforms rely on regulated payment methods such as BankID in Scandinavian countries or e-wallets secured with two-factor authentication. These tools act as indirect verification, confirming player identity through trusted financial networks instead of manual document uploads.
In addition, these casinos often use SSL encryption to protect data transmissions and collaborate with reputable software providers like Evolution Gaming for live casino streaming. The gamble here is trusting technology to replace paperwork, and so far, the industry has been cautiously optimistic.
Of course, not all no verification casinos are created equal; regulatory oversight varies depending on jurisdiction. This means players should stay alert and choose platforms that have clear licensing from regulators like the Malta Gaming Authority or Curacao eGaming. These measures help maintain fairness and security without turning the user experience into a tedious ordeal.
